What You’ll Need

Gather the following ingredients to whip up these delightful breakfast potatoes.

For the Potatoes

  • 4 Potatoes, cut into 1/2" cubes
  • 1/4 tsp Salt
  • 1/4 tsp Black pepper
  • 1/4 tsp Garlic powder
  • 1/4 tsp Onion powder

For Cooking

  • 1 tbsp Butter
  • 1 tbsp Oil

For Serving

  • 1 tbsp Chopped parsley (fresh, or 1/2 tsp dried)

Use any starchy potato like Russets for best results.

How to Make It

Start by preparing the potatoes and heating up your skillet.

Cut potatoes

Cut all potatoes into small 1/2" cubes. This ensures they cook evenly and develop a delightful texture.

Heat skillet

Heat skillet to medium high heat and add butter and oil. This combination will create a rich flavor for the potatoes.

Add potatoes

Add chopped potatoes to the hot skillet and toss around to fully coat in the butter/oil combination. This helps in achieving a crisp outside.

Sprinkle seasonings

Sprinkle potatoes with seasonings except for the parsley. Cover to let potatoes lightly steam for about 3-4 minutes. This technique will give them a tender center.

Stir potatoes

Remove the lid and stir potatoes. Continue to cook potatoes with the lid off, turning them with a spatula to ensure even cooking on all sides.

Check doneness

When potatoes are done, they will have a light crisp on the outside and a soft texture on the inside.

Serve

Sprinkle potatoes with fresh parsley and serve. This adds a pop of color and freshness to the dish.

How to Store It

Fridge: Store for up to 3 days in an airtight container.
Freezer: No, they will become mushy when thawed.
Reheat: Use the skillet over medium heat for 5-7 minutes.

Tips for Best Results

  • Ensure your skillet is hot before adding potatoes for maximum crispiness.
  • Cut potatoes uniformly to promote even cooking.
  • Experiment with different seasonings like paprika or Italian herbs.
  • For extra flavor, sauté some onions or peppers with the potatoes.
